(a) There is a beer and wine (hotel-limited service) license. (b) The Board may issue the license to a person who owns or leases a hotel that contains: (1) at least 50 rooms; and (2) a kitchen licensed to operate as a food service facility. (c) The license authorizes the license holder to sell beer and wine every day at one or more locations in the hotel for on-premises consumption. (d) The annual license fee is $2,400 to be paid on or before May 1.
